Daegu National Museum
Daegu National Museum
Located in Suseong-gu, this national museum opened in 1994 to preserve and display the history and culture of the Daegu region. Visitors go here to view a collection of regional artifacts and historical exhibits that document the area's development over time.
Getting There
The museum is situated south of the city centre. Depending on the starting point, it can be reached via public bus or taxi. The journey typically takes 30 to 50 minutes from the central business district.
Visit Duration
Allow approximately 2 to 3 hours to walk through the galleries and view the primary exhibits at a steady pace.
When to Visit
The museum is an indoor venue, making it a consistent option regardless of the season. To avoid larger groups, visiting on weekday mornings is generally quieter than weekends.
